Sawyer Products is on a mission to keep you safe and healthy on any outdoor journey – and to pay that forward to communities in need. Since 1984 they’ve been innovating top-notch water filters, insect repellents, and first aid gear right out of Florida. Hikers and campers swear by the ultralight Sawyer Squeeze and Mini filters, which let you drink from wild streams and lakes with 0.1-micron filtration (no more lugging heavy water jugs!). In fact, Sawyer’s filters can treat up to 100,000 gallons of water and remove 99.99999% of bacteria – they’re built for the long haul and harsh conditions. But what really sets Sawyer apart is their humanitarian heart: in 2008 they launched a Clean Water for All initiative, and they now devote 90% of their profits to donating water filters globally. Through partnerships with 140+ charities in over 80 countries, Sawyer filters are providing clean drinking water to millions who need it – even helping make Liberia the first developing nation with 100% access to clean water.
